Software Engineer II

Condé Nast

Job Summary

Condé Nast is seeking an experienced Software Engineer II to join their team in Bengaluru, India. This role involves building the next generation of digital products, collaborating with product teams, and scaling public-facing platforms. The engineer will lead projects from ideation to execution, improve code and usability performance, participate in design and code reviews, and help expand engineering teams. Key tasks include implementing complex React frontends and Node.js applications, and optimizing dynamic websites.

Must Have

  • Collaborate with engineering, design, and product teams in web application creation.
  • Lead projects from ideation to execution and maintenance.
  • Identify and improve code and usability performance issues.
  • Participate in design and code reviews.
  • Implement complex React frontends and Node.js applications.
  • Develop new concepts and libraries for dynamic website optimization.
  • Hands-on experience in front-end development using React, JavaScript, and Node.js.
  • Comfortable building scalable, user-friendly web applications.
  • Design, develop, and maintain responsive web applications using React.
  • Build reusable components and front-end libraries.
  • Translate UI/UX designs into high-quality, clean, and efficient code.
  • Optimize applications for performance, scalability, and cross-browser compatibility.
  • Write unit and integration tests for front-end components.
  • Develop and maintain Node.js services and APIs.
  • Integrate front-end applications with RESTful or GraphQL APIs.
  • Handle basic backend logic, validations, and error handling.

Good to Have

  • Database knowledge
  • Docker
  • Kubernetes Elasticsearch

Job Description

Condé Nast is a global media company producing the highest quality content with a footprint of more than 1 billion consumers in 32 territories through print, digital, video and social platforms. The company’s portfolio includes many of the world’s most respected and influential media properties including Vogue, Vanity Fair, Glamour, Self, GQ, The New Yorker, Condé Nast Traveler/Traveller, Allure, AD, Bon Appétit and Wired, among others.

Job Description

Location:

Bengaluru, KA

About The Role:

Condé Nast is looking for an experienced engineer to join and help us build the next generation of our digital products. You will work closely with our product teams and help the engineering team in their shared mission to scale out and build our public-facing platform. These teams’ focus spans many types of products essential to both editors, other engineers, and subscribers. Your work will drive the future of Condé Nast’s digital strategy in today’s publishing market and reach our millions of readers around the world.

About Responsibilities:

  • Collaborate with other disciplines (engineering, design, product) in the creation and iteration of web applications built for our subscribers
  • Helping leading projects from ideation to execution to maintenance
  • Collaborating with the broader engineering group on new ideas or improving existing ones
  • Identify and improve code and usability performance issues
  • Participate in design and code reviews
  • Helping us grow and expand our engineering teams in Implementation of complex React frontends and Node apps using a mix of Express, NestJs and others
  • Inception of new concepts and libraries for the optimization of dynamic websites

Desired Skills and Qualifications

  • hands-on experience in front-end development using React and solid knowledge of JavaScript and Node.js.
  • The ideal candidate should be comfortable building scalable, user-friendly web applications and collaborating closely with backend and product teams.
  • Database knowledge is a plus.

Front-End:

  • Design, develop, and maintain responsive web applications using React
  • Build reusable components and front-end libraries
  • Translate UI/UX designs into high-quality, clean, and efficient code
  • Optimize applications for performance, scalability, and cross-browser compatibility
  • Write unit and integration tests for front-end components

Backend:

  • Develop and maintain Node.js services and APIs
  • Integrate front-end applications with RESTful or GraphQL APIs
  • Handle basic backend logic, validations, and error handling

Our tech:

  • Languages and Frameworks: Javascript, Node.JS, React (and React ecosystem)
  • Front-end: HTML5, CSS3, LESS, Sass, Styled Components, Tailwind CSS
  • APIs: GraphQL, Rest
  • Data: MongoDB, SQL
  • Source Control: Git, GitHub
  • Deployment: Docker (Good to have), AWS
  • Kubernetes Elasticsearch (Good to have)

What happens next?

If you are interested in this opportunity, please apply below, and we will review your application as soon as possible. You can update your resume or upload a cover letter at any time by accessing your candidate profile.

Condé Nast is an equal opportunity employer. We evaluate qualified appl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, veteran status, age, familial status and other legally protected characteristics.

18 Skills Required For This Role

Github Game Texts React Html Aws Elasticsearch Node.js Mongodb Docker Sass Front End Graphql Nestjs Kubernetes Git Sql Javascript Css